Ranh - Koohar

Jhulelal Sesa

This is one of the simplest Sindhi recipes. Usually, Koohar or Ranh are cooked to distribute as the prasad along with either Tanhiree ” Jhulelal” or with Kanhan Prasad in the Guru Darbars. Some people also cook for mixing with other vegetables and making Parathas. Ranh Ja Paratha and Papad is used many times by Sindhi families as breakfast.

Ranh - Koohar Cooking Process

[1] Took good quality Kohar or Ranh.
[2] Clean & Soak them in water for about 2  Hours.
[3] Separate this water. Take fresh water in Pressure cooker [ Water Ranh Ratio is about 1.5 : 1] add Salt to taste.
[4] Cook for about 15-20 minutes.
